Comparison of periodontitis-associated oral biofilm formation under dynamic and static conditions.

Won Sub SongJae-Kwan LeeSe Hwan ParkHeung-Sik UmSi Young LeeBeom-Seok Chang
Published in: Journal of periodontal & implant science (2017)
When used to reproduce periodontal biofilms composed of F. nucleatum and P. gingivalis, the dynamic method (CDC biofilm reactor) formed looser biofilms containing fewer bacteria than the well plate. However, this difference did not influence the thickness of the biofilms or the activity of chlorhexidine. Therefore, both methods are useful for mimicking periodontitis-associated oral biofilms.
